In LoL, cosmetic changes are available at a better price. The special promotion ‘Your Shop’ makes the purchase of skins more attractive.

For many LoL fans and long-term active players, a good time has come to buy some of the desired skins. Because with “Your Shop”, the popular special promotion in League of Legends returns for one month.

If you’ve resisted the temptation of expensive skins and saved diligently, patience may have paid off. “Your Shop” will be available in League of Legends from 10 February to 9 March.

With “Your Shop” you have the opportunity to get hold of some skins at a significant discount. Due to the way the shop works, chances are good that you will find exactly what you like. The contents of the shop are individually tailored to the players. Some of the most expensive skins (1350 Riot Points) may even be available for half price.

There is another reason to at least take a look at “Your Shop”. Because the skins offered there may be from a skin series that has been discontinued or is otherwise no longer available. However, there are some exceptions and not all skins may appear in the shop.

Ultimate skins, for example, are not normally placed in “Your Shop” by Riot Games, and the Hextech skin line is only available through the use of Gemstones. While the shop promo is active, regular promotions and discounts will also continue.
